Dynamo is backend-agnostic and Kubernetes-native without being Kubernetes-only. Use this container path to try the same frontend/router/worker stack locally; use the Kubernetes path when you want the operator, CRDs, Gateway API integration, autoscaling, scheduling, and cluster lifecycle management.

## Pull a Container

#### CUDA

Containers have all dependencies pre-installed. Pick your backend:

#### SGLang

```bash
docker run --gpus all --network host --rm -it nvcr.io/nvidia/ai-dynamo/sglang-runtime:1.3.0
```

#### TensorRT-LLM

```bash
docker run --gpus all --network host --rm -it nvcr.io/nvidia/ai-dynamo/tensorrtllm-runtime:1.3.0
```

#### vLLM

```bash
docker run --gpus all --network host --rm -it nvcr.io/nvidia/ai-dynamo/vllm-runtime:1.3.0
```

For container versions and tags, see [Release Artifacts](/dynamo/resources/release-artifacts#container-images).

#### XPU

XPU images are not pre-built — build from source first. Pick your backend:

#### vLLM

```bash
git clone https://github.com/ai-dynamo/dynamo.git
cd dynamo
container/render.py --framework=vllm --device=xpu --target=runtime
docker build -t dynamo:latest-vllm-xpu-runtime \
  -f container/vllm-runtime-xpu-amd64-rendered.Dockerfile .
container/run.sh --image dynamo:latest-vllm-xpu-runtime --device=xpu -it
```

#### SGLang

```bash
git clone https://github.com/ai-dynamo/dynamo.git
cd dynamo
container/render.py --framework=sglang --device=xpu --target=runtime
docker build -t dynamo:latest-sglang-xpu-runtime \
  -f container/sglang-runtime-xpu-amd64-rendered.Dockerfile .
container/run.sh --image dynamo:latest-sglang-xpu-runtime --device=xpu -it
```

**Hugging Face token required for gated models.** Llama, Kimi, Qwen-VL, and other gated models require `HF_TOKEN` in your environment and accepting the model card's license on huggingface.co. Set `export HF_TOKEN=hf_…` before launching.

## Start the Frontend

In your container, start the OpenAI-compatible frontend on port 8000:

```bash
python3 -m dynamo.frontend --discovery-backend file
```

`--discovery-backend file` avoids needing etcd. To run frontend and worker in the same terminal, background each command with `> logfile.log 2>&1 &`.

## Start a Worker

In another terminal, launch a worker for your backend:

#### CUDA

#### SGLang

```bash
python3 -m dynamo.sglang --model-path Qwen/Qwen3-0.6B --discovery-backend file
```

#### TensorRT-LLM

```bash
python3 -m dynamo.trtllm --model-path Qwen/Qwen3-0.6B --discovery-backend file
```

#### vLLM

```bash
python3 -m dynamo.vllm --model Qwen/Qwen3-0.6B --discovery-backend file
```

#### XPU

#### vLLM

```bash
VLLM_TARGET_DEVICE=xpu \
  python3 -m dynamo.vllm --model Qwen/Qwen3-0.6B --discovery-backend file
```

#### SGLang

```bash
python3 -m dynamo.sglang --model-path Qwen/Qwen3-0.6B --discovery-backend file
```

## Verify and Test

Check the endpoint is up:

```bash
curl -sf http://localhost:8000/health && echo OK
```

If you see `OK`, send a chat completion:

```bash title="Request"
curl localhost:8000/v1/chat/completions \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{"model": "Qwen/Qwen3-0.6B",
       "messages": [{"role": "user", "content": "Hello!"}],
       "max_tokens": 50}'
```

```json title="Response"
{
  "id": "chatcmpl-...",
  "model": "Qwen/Qwen3-0.6B",
  "choices": [{
    "index": 0,
    "message": {"role": "assistant", "content": "Hello! How can I help you today?"},
    "finish_reason": "stop"
  }],
  "usage": {"prompt_tokens": 9, "completion_tokens": 10, "total_tokens": 19}
}
```

Connection refused? The frontend takes a few seconds to start — retry. For production liveness and readiness probes, see [Health Checks](/dynamo/user-guides/observability-local/health-checks).
